Understanding how e-cigarettes operate is crucial for anyone looking to transition from traditional smoking to a potentially safer alternative. E-cigarettes, also known as electronic cigarettes or vapes, are designed to simulate the experience of smoking without the combustion of tobacco. The fundamental mechanism behind these devices involves the heating of a liquid solution known as e-liquid or vape juice.

Components of an E-Cigarette

Typically, e-cigarettes consist of several key parts: a battery, an atomizer, a cartridge or tank, and mouthpiece. The battery powers the atomizer, which heats the e-liquid contained in the cartridge or tank. Once heated, the liquid turns into vapor, which the user inhales through the mouthpiece.

Battery

At the core of an e-cigarette’s operation is a rechargeable lithium-ion battery. This battery is responsible for supplying energy to the atomizer. Depending on the model, these batteries can vary in capacity and voltage, impacting the vapor production and overall performance.

Atomizer

The atomizer is essentially a heating element within the e-cigarette. When activated, usually by inhaling or pressing a button, the atomizer heats up and vaporizes the e-liquid. This component can come in various forms, including coils, wicks, and tanks that work together to facilitate vaporization.

Cartridge or Tank

This element serves as the reservoir for the e-liquid. Users can refill these tanks with different flavors and nicotine strengths, offering a customizable experience. The design of the cartridge or tank can influence the ease of use and the overall satisfaction with the device.

E-liquid, also known as vape juice, is a blend of propylene glycol (PG), vegetable glycerin (VG), flavorings, and often nicotine. The proportions of PG and VG can affect the throat hit and vapor production, with higher VG concentrations typically producing more vapor. Quality of ingredients and flavor choices contribute significantly to the vaping experience.

Nicotine Levels

The nicotine content in e-liquids can vary widely, allowing users to choose strengths that suit their preferences or aid in gradual cessation. Some prefer nicotine-free liquids, while others opt for higher levels to replicate the sensation of smoking.

Benefits of E-Cigarettes Over Traditional Smoking

Many consider e-cigarettes to be less harmful than conventional smoking, primarily due to the absence of combustion. When tobacco burns, it releases numerous harmful chemicals. E-cigarettes, on the other hand, do not produce these toxins. While not entirely risk-free, they offer a smoke-free and often odorless alternative.

Variety of Flavors

The availability of a wide array of flavors in e-liquids is another appealing factor. From classic tobacco to exotic fruit blends, users can enjoy unique tastes while also tailoring their nicotine intake.

Are e-cigarettes safe?

While e-cigarettes are considered less harmful than traditional cigarettes, they are not without risks. Long-term effects are still being studied, but current evidence suggests they are safer than smoking tobacco.

Do e-cigarettes help quit smoking?

Many individuals have successfully used e-cigarettes as a tool to quit smoking. However, results can vary, and combining them with other cessation methods may increase effectiveness.
